Use of statistical data
3.8.34 Every statement and comment included in the Review should be specific and vagueness should be eschewed. Statements or comments that are not specific in terms of location, the office involved, the person responsible, etc. would enable to administrative ministry or department either to ignore them or evade furnishing replies on the pretext that the comments not being specific, response is not possible. To cite an example, a comment such as "in one district due to the negligence of an executive officer misappropriation of Rs 5 lakhs took place" is not specific and does not enable identification of
(i) the district;
(ii) the nature of the negligence that facilitated the misappropriation;
(iii) the person
(s) who misappropriated the amount; etc. The comment does not also facilitate an appreciation of the follow-up action, if any, taken and its current status.
